All of the animals posted on our site have been temperament tested. While not all are in the immediate area, once we have processed and approved your application, we will move the dog to our adoptive area for you to meet, greet and hopefully adopt. Sometimes we will have more than one application on a dog. That does not mean it automatically goes to another family but you should be aware of the fact that until you are approved and set up for the meet/greet.. the dog could get adopted by another applicant.

"Just kill her," they said. "We don't want her anymore, we're moving", and, without a backward glance, they walked away from sweet little Coco Puff. Coco, as we affectionately call her, has been loving and a good girl all her life. We couldn't let it all end like that. So, she is now safe with us, looking for a home where she will be loved for the wonderful , happy little dog that she is. Fine with other dogs, but not cats, her biggest joy in life, aside from trotting around the backyard and sniffing all the good scents, is lap sitting. If you sit down, prepare to have Coco begging for a spot on or near you. She will curl up in a ball, or, if she is feeling especially lazy, just stretch out across your lap like a big, warm sock! With winter coming on, you can think of her as a pettable lap/foot warmer! Although she is a senior, about her only complaint are her dry eyes, and that's an easy one. We have eye drops for her that solve that problem simply.  And although she is 8 years old, doxies are one of the longest lived breeds, so it is more than likely that she has many years left in front of her to snuggle with you. A great personality and temperament round out the Coco package. Who can resist this little girl!
